« Squier Stratocaster »
Published on 03/08/04 at 15:00I bought a rather fetching 3 tone sunburst squier stratocaster in a starter pack from Sound Control in Birminham, UK. It cost roughly £200, withsaid guitar, a small 10w practice amp, 3 free picks, a tutorial cd and video.
It looks soooooooooooooooooooooooooooooooooo sweet.
The first one I got, the tremolo arm cross threaded, and no humbucker, like my mates Fender...![:( :(](https://static.audiofanzine.com/images/audiofanzine/interface/smileys/icon_sad.gif)
On my new, current one... excellent.
It rules, and I learnt my first solo (AC/DC's You Shook Me All Night Long' on it. 4th position pickup selection sounds best. So I took it back and got it replaced with a newer guitar with a better action and unbelievably good fretboard..? I upgraded! For free!
